commit and release note naming conventions

Open jasondellaluce opened this issue 2 years ago • 19 comments

What to document

We have no definite naming conventions for either commits or release notes (I don't think we have release notes at all).

In Falco, we have a naming convention for release notes touching rulesets (see: https://github.com/falcosecurity/.github/blob/main/CONTRIBUTING.md#rule-type), but although this repository is the official place for all our plugin rulesets, we haven't something like this here.

At the same time, our changelog generation tool looks for commit messages following conventional commits specifications. For a given plugin, the changelog will filter commit messages in the form of xxx(plugins): ... or xxx(plugins/<plugin_name>): .... However, there is nothing enforcing this at the CI level, not even with a warning, which ends up potentially missing valuable commits in the changelogs.

*Proposals/Idea

  • Add a CI job checking that:
    • If a file changes in a plugin/<plugin_name> path, then the commit must follow the xxx(plugins/<plugin_name>): ... message pattern
    • If a file changes in more than one plugin/<plugin_name> path, then the commit must follow the xxx(plugins): ... message pattern
  • Check or enforce than the rule(xxx):... commit message format is respected, even in a looser form than what we have in Falco
